#import <Foundation/Foundation.h>
#import "Testing.h"
#import "ObjectTesting.h"
#if defined(GS_USE_ICU)
#define NSLOCALE_SUPPORTED GS_USE_ICU
#else
#define NSLOCALE_SUPPORTED 1 /* Assume Apple support */
#endif
int main()
{
NSNumberFormatter *fmt;
NSNumber *num;
NSString *str;
START_SET("NSNumberFormatter")
PASS(NSNumberFormatterBehavior10_4
== [NSNumberFormatter defaultFormatterBehavior],
"default behavior is NSNumberFormatterBehavior10_4")
[NSNumberFormatter
setDefaultFormatterBehavior: NSNumberFormatterBehavior10_0];
PASS(NSNumberFormatterBehavior10_0
== [NSNumberFormatter defaultFormatterBehavior],
"default behavior can be changed to NSNumberFormatterBehavior10_0")
[NSNumberFormatter
setDefaultFormatterBehavior: NSNumberFormatterBehaviorDefault];
PASS(NSNumberFormatterBehavior10_4
== [NSNumberFormatter defaultFormatterBehavior],
"NSNumberFormatterBehaviorDefault gives NSNumberFormatterBehavior10_4")
[NSNumberFormatter
setDefaultFormatterBehavior: NSNumberFormatterBehavior10_0];
[NSNumberFormatter setDefaultFormatterBehavior: 1234];
PASS(1234 == [NSNumberFormatter defaultFormatterBehavior],
"unknown behavior is accepted")
[NSNumberFormatter
setDefaultFormatterBehavior: NSNumberFormatterBehavior10_4];
PASS(NSNumberFormatterBehavior10_4
== [NSNumberFormatter defaultFormatterBehavior],
"default behavior can be changed to NSNumberFormatterBehavior10_4")
fmt = [[[NSNumberFormatter alloc] init] autorelease];
PASS(NSNumberFormatterBehavior10_4 == [fmt formatterBehavior],
"a new formatter gets the current default behavior")
[fmt setFormatterBehavior: NSNumberFormatterBehaviorDefault];
PASS(NSNumberFormatterBehaviorDefault == [fmt formatterBehavior],
"a new formatter can have the default behavior set")
str = [fmt stringFromNumber: [NSDecimalNumber notANumber]];
PASS_EQUAL(str, @"NaN", "notANumber special case")
START_SET("NSLocale")
NSLocale *sys;
NSLocale *en;
if (!NSLOCALE_SUPPORTED)
SKIP("NSLocale not supported\nThe ICU library was not available when GNUstep-base was built")
sys = [NSLocale systemLocale];
[fmt setLocale: sys];
PASS([fmt getObjectValue: &num forString: @"0.00" errorDescription: 0]
&& num != nil, "formatting suceeded")
if (testPassed)
{
PASS(NO == [num isEqual: [NSDecimalNumber notANumber]],
"is not equal to NaN")
PASS(YES == [num isEqual: [NSDecimalNumber zero]],
"is equal to zero")
}
num = [[[NSNumber alloc] initWithFloat: 1234.567] autorelease];
str = [fmt stringFromNumber: num];
PASS_EQUAL(str, @"1235", "default 10.4 format same as Cocoa")
en = [[[NSLocale alloc] initWithLocaleIdentifier: @"en"] autorelease];
PASS_EQUAL([en localeIdentifier], @"en", "have locale 'en'");
[fmt setLocale: en];
[fmt setPaddingCharacter: @"+"];
PASS_EQUAL([fmt paddingCharacter], @"+", "padding character se to '+'")
[fmt setPaddingCharacter: @"*"]; // Subsequent tests use '*'
[fmt setMaximumFractionDigits: 2];
str = [fmt stringFromNumber: num];
PASS_EQUAL(str, @"1234.57", "round up for fractional part >0.5")
num = [[[NSNumber alloc] initWithFloat: 1234.432] autorelease];
str = [fmt stringFromNumber: num];
PASS_EQUAL(str, @"1234.43", "round down for fractional part <0.5")
num = [[[NSNumber alloc] initWithFloat: -1234.43] autorelease];
[fmt setMaximumFractionDigits: 1];
[fmt setMinusSign: @"_"];
PASS_EQUAL([fmt stringFromNumber: num], @"_1234.4",
"minus sign assigned correctly");
[fmt setPercentSymbol: @"##"];
[fmt setNumberStyle: NSNumberFormatterPercentStyle];
testHopeful = YES;
PASS_EQUAL([fmt stringFromNumber: num], @"_123,443##",
"Negative percentage correct");
testHopeful = NO;
num = [[[NSNumber alloc] initWithFloat: 1234.432] autorelease];
[fmt setNumberStyle: NSNumberFormatterNoStyle];
[fmt setMaximumFractionDigits: 0];
[fmt setFormatWidth: 6];
str = [fmt stringFromNumber: num];
PASS([str isEqual: @"**1234"] || [str isEqual: @" 1234"],
"format width set correctly");
[fmt setPositivePrefix: @"+"];
str = [fmt stringFromNumber: num];
PASS([str isEqual: @"*+1234"] || [str isEqual: @" +1234"],
"positive prefix set correctly");
[fmt setPaddingCharacter: @"0"];
str = [fmt stringFromNumber: num];
PASS_EQUAL(str, @"0+1234", "default padding position is before prefix");
[fmt setPaddingPosition: NSNumberFormatterPadAfterPrefix];
str = [fmt stringFromNumber: num];
PASS_EQUAL(str, @"+01234", "numeric and space padding OK")
num = [[[NSNumber alloc] initWithFloat: 1234.56] autorelease];
[fmt setNumberStyle: NSNumberFormatterCurrencyStyle];
[fmt setLocale: [[NSLocale alloc] initWithLocaleIdentifier: @"pt_BR"]];
testHopeful = YES;
PASS_EQUAL([fmt stringFromNumber: num], @"+1.235",
"currency style does not include currency string");
testHopeful = NO;
[fmt setPositivePrefix: @"+"];
PASS_EQUAL([fmt stringFromNumber: num], @"+1.235",
"positive prefix is set correctly for currency style");
[fmt setPositiveSuffix: @"c"];
PASS_EQUAL([fmt stringFromNumber: num], @"+1.235c",
"prefix and suffix used properly");
num = [[[NSNumber alloc] initWithFloat: -1234.56] autorelease];
/* Different versions of ICU use different formats, so we need to
* permit alternative results.
*/
str = [fmt stringFromNumber: num];
PASS([str isEqual: @"(R$1.235)"] || [str isEqual: @"_R$1.235"],
"negativeFormat used for -ve number");
[fmt setNumberStyle: NSNumberFormatterNoStyle];
testHopeful = YES;
PASS_EQUAL([fmt stringFromNumber: num], @"_01235",
"format string of length 1")
testHopeful = NO;
END_SET("NSLocale")
END_SET("NSNumberFormatter")
return 0;
}
